Hey Varo — handing off the GC pause mess in the Pairloom matching service. Pauses spike past 800ms during nightly reindex; I've pinned it to the old-gen survivor churn. Tuning notes are in the Brindlecove runbook. To pull the heap dumps you'll need the sealed diagnostics vault, which opens with the recovery passphrase written directly below.

vault phrase of yagag-kadup = belael-druius-rusax-kelox

# Break-Glass: SnapLoom Snapshot Suite

Contractors: if the SnapLoom UI snapshot pipeline locks up and baselines can't be approved, use break-glass access. Scope is read-write on the baseline store only. Log the incident in the runbook within one hour. Access requires unsealing the emergency credential bundle on the jump host. Unseal it with the recovery passphrase below.

unlock words, tawif-tahop: oliys-ulawyn-tamdor-lamys-casox-jormir-fraius-kasath-ulador-ulamir-holir-sorys-holeth

Subject: Handing off the planner regression work

Hi all,

Quick heads-up for whoever inherits this later: I'm rotating off the Quillbase query planner regression (the one where join reordering blows up on wide star schemas). The bisect notes live in the `planner-regress` branch, and the repro script is in `tools/repro_star.sh`. Don't trust the cost estimates in the 4.2 snapshot — they're stale. Everything else is documented in the runbook. Going forward, ownership of this investigation transfers to the engineer named below.

named custodian: Oliath Ralax